About

United Airlines Holdings, Inc., through its subsidiaries, provides air transportation services in the United States, Canada, Atlantic, the Pacific, and Latin America. It transports people and cargo through its mainline and regional fleets. United Airlines Holdings Inc (UAL) - Total Liabilities

Latest total liabilities as of December 2025: $61.17 Billion USD

Based on the latest financial reports, United Airlines Holdings Inc (UAL) has total liabilities worth $61.17 Billion USD as of December 2025.

Total liabilities represent everything the company owes to external parties, combining both current liabilities—like accounts payable, short-term debt, and accrued expenses—and non-current liabilities such as long-term debt, pension obligations, lease liabilities, and deferred tax liabilities.

Liquidity & Leverage Metrics

Key Metrics Explained

Metric Value Description
Current Ratio 0.65 Measures ability to pay short-term obligations (Current Assets ÷ Current Liabilities)
Quick Ratio N/A More stringent measure of short-term liquidity ((Current Assets - Inventory) ÷ Current Liabilities)
Cash Ratio N/A Most conservative liquidity measure (Cash & Equivalents ÷ Current Liabilities)
Debt to Equity 4.00 Measures financial leverage (Total Liabilities ÷ Shareholder Equity)
Debt to Assets 0.80 Portion of assets financed with debt (Total Liabilities ÷ Total Assets)

Annual Total Liabilities for United Airlines Holdings Inc (1983–2025)

The table below shows the annual total liabilities of United Airlines Holdings Inc from 1983 to 2025.

Year Total Liabilities Change
2025-12-31 $61.17 Billion -0.39%
2024-12-31 $61.41 Billion -0.60%
2023-12-31 $61.78 Billion +2.18%
2022-12-31 $60.46 Billion -4.25%
2021-12-31 $63.15 Billion +17.84%
2020-12-31 $53.59 Billion +30.45%
2019-12-31 $41.08 Billion +5.38%
2018-12-31 $38.98 Billion +15.98%
2017-12-31 $33.61 Billion +6.77%
2016-12-31 $31.48 Billion -1.30%
2015-12-31 $31.89 Billion -6.74%
2014-12-31 $34.20 Billion +1.10%
2013-12-31 $33.83 Billion -8.93%
2012-12-31 $37.15 Billion +2.67%
2011-12-31 $36.18 Billion -4.46%
2010-12-31 $37.87 Billion +76.19%
2009-12-31 $21.50 Billion -1.34%
2008-12-31 $21.79 Billion -0.07%
2007-12-31 $21.80 Billion -6.11%
2006-12-31 $23.22 Billion -48.29%
2005-12-31 $44.90 Billion +58.19%
2004-12-31 $28.39 Billion +1.76%
2003-12-31 $27.89 Billion +6.72%
2002-12-31 $26.14 Billion +17.93%
2001-12-31 $22.16 Billion +15.65%
2000-12-31 $19.16 Billion +21.21%
1999-12-31 $15.81 Billion +3.50%
1998-12-31 $15.28 Billion +13.46%
1997-12-31 $13.47 Billion +15.58%
1996-12-31 $11.65 Billion -1.44%
1995-12-31 $11.82 Billion -1.75%
1994-12-31 $12.03 Billion +3.70%
1993-12-31 $11.60 Billion +0.44%
1992-12-31 $11.55 Billion +39.52%
1991-12-31 $8.28 Billion +31.16%
1990-12-31 $6.31 Billion +11.88%
1989-12-31 $5.64 Billion +3.05%
1988-12-31 $5.47 Billion +0.15%
1987-12-31 $5.47 Billion +32.24%
1986-12-31 $4.13 Billion -34.54%
1985-12-31 $6.32 Billion +79.61%
1984-12-31 $3.52 Billion -5.91%
1983-12-31 $3.74 Billion --
